RESIDENTIAL AREA NORTH OF DOWNTOWN HAYWARD

 One of the most dramatic examples of creep is to be found in a residential area north of downtown Hayward at the corner of Rose and Prospect Streets.

Photographs taken over twenty years show the offset of the curb by creep.

The first picture was taken in 1971.

The next was in 1974, note the red paint overspray.

In 1979, there was about two centimeters or nearly an inch of creep movement that has offset the curb.

Note the change in the position of the curb from 1987 to the location in 1993 in the next picture.

Location in 1993.
